Didn't they ban GMOs in the UK?

GMOs cannot be grown for commercial use in the UK, but we have had trail fields of crops which protesters destroyed. As far as I know there are no farmers in the UK growing GM crops (I'll stand corrected on that one) because of all the bad press, and hassle.
